Isishwankathelo
Isixhobo sisebenzisa itekhnoloji ye-reverse direction multiplexing ukudibanisa kwiisekethe ezininzi ze-E1 ukuhambisa idatha ye-Ethernet ye-4Channel 100BASE-TX. Iyakwazi ukuqonda ukuguqulwa phakathi kwe-1 ~ 8 itshaneli ye-E1 kunye ne-Ethernet ujongano olubonakalayo, ukwenza iziteshi ze-E1 ezidityaniswe ne-Ethernet interface optical. Ukusebenzisa i-GFP encapsulation, xhasa i-LCS (isikimu sokulungelelanisa umthamo) kunye neprotocol ye-LAPS.
Esi sixhobo sinokuxhasa ubumbeko lwetshaneli ye-1-8 yeChaneli E1, inokubona ngokuzenzekelayo inani le-E1 kwaye ukhethe i-E1 ekhoyo. Ivumela i-E1 imigca yokuhambisa ixesha, i-1channel/4channel/8channel Ethernet bandwidth is1984Kbit/s, 7936Kbit/s, 15872 Kbit/s.
Isixhobo sibonelela ngomsebenzi we-alamu. Umsebenzi unokwethenjelwa kwaye uphantsi kokusetyenziswa kwamandla, ukudibanisa okuphezulu, ubungakanani obuncinci. Inkxaso Ulawulo lweNethiwekhi , Umsebenzi oyintloko wenkqubo yolawulo lwenethiwekhi kukuzalisekisa uphando lwezixhobo zendawo kunye nezikude kunye nolawulo loqwalaselo olubandakanya ukubuza ubume be-alarm kumgca we-E1, isimo sokusebenza se-Ethernet, kunye nokulawulwa kwe-loopback njl.

Iimbonakalo
- Ukuhanjiswa okucacileyo kwedatha ye-Ethernet kwi-1 ukuya kwi-8 yeesekethe ze-E1;
- Inokuxhotyiswa nge-Ethernet emine yokutshintsha ujongano lombane ukuze umsebenzisi agcine iswitshi ye-Ethernet;
- I-Ethernet 10/100M, i-duplex epheleleyo / isiqingatha iguquguquka ngokupheleleyo, inkxaso yeprotocol yeVLAN;
- Ichweba ngalinye lixhasa inkxaso ye-Ethernet ye-AUTO-MDIX (ikhebula le-crossover kunye ne-straight-line adaptation);
- I-interface ye-Ethernet nayo i-optical interfaces yokuzikhethela ukuphumeza ukuhanjiswa kwedatha ye-Ethernet ngokudibanisa i-E1 kude;
- I-8-channel E1 imigca, umahluko omkhulu wokulibaziseka phakathi kwazo naziphi na ezimbini unokufikelela kwi-220ms; xa ukulibaziseka ukulibaziseka ngaphezu kwe-220ms, ukulibaziseka kuya kuvelisa i-alarm engafanelekanga, ngelixa ukuphazamiseka kwezoshishino;
- Uluhlu lwedilesi ye-Ethernet ye-MAC eyakhiwe ngamandla (4096), kunye nomsebenzi wokucoca isakhelo sedatha yendawo;
- I-interface ye-E1 ihambelana ne-ITU-T G.703, G.704 kunye ne-G.823, ayixhasi ukusetyenziswa kweendawo zokubonisa;
- Imowudi yexesha, ixesha elikhethiweyo lendawo kunye nokulandelela ixesha lomgca we-E1, umthombo wexesha lomgca we-E1 unokutshintshwa ngokuzenzekelayo ngokomgangatho wesignali. Njengenkqubo yomthombo wexesha le-E1 kwiNdlela yokuqala ye-E1, xa ukusilela kwe-E1 yokuqala (isilumkiso esinzulu LOS/AIS/LOF/CRC4 okanye isiginali yokuvelisa iluphu) kunye nomendo wesibini u-E1 usebenza ngokufanelekileyo, inkqubo iya kutshintshela ngokuzenzekelayo kumzila. Indlela yesibini E1; ukupheliswa kwesiphoso, inkqubo emva koko ibuyele ngokuzenzekelayo kwindlela yokuqala ye-E1;
- Ukuthotyelwa kweprotocol ye-ITU-T esemgangathweni, isiphakamiso se-GFP-F ye-encapsulation G.7041, i-VCAT yokudibanisa i-virtual kunye ne-LCAS Link Capacity Adjustment iingcebiso G.7042, i-Ethernet mapping ukuya kwi-nxE1 ncomo G.7043, i-Ethernet ukuya kwi-E1 enye ingcebiso yemephu G. 8040;
- Xa i-bandwidth yokudlulisa inyuka, ayiyi kulimaza idatha ye-Ethernet; Ukuhanjiswa kwe-bandwidth kuncitshiswe ngokwenziwa, kunokuqondwa ngaphandle kokonakalisa inethiwekhi yedatha ye-Ethernet;
- Iziphelo ze-E1 ze-tributary zisenokungahambelani noqhagamshelo olulandelelanayo;
- Xa isalathiso esinye sokutyibilika i-E1 sisilela, elinye icala lingasebenza;
- I-loop yesignali ye-E1 ngasemva kwaye inqumle umsebenzi wokufumanisa ngokuzenzekelayo: Xa ufumanisa ukwenzeka kwendlela ye-loop ye-E1 yendlela, inkqubo inqunyulwe le E1; i-loopback ikhululiwe, i-E1 yokubuyisela ngokuzenzekelayo sebenzisa le ndlela;
- Gqibezela isibonakaliso se-alam, khetha ukubonisa i-alam yasekhaya / ekude;
- Ixhasa i-E1 ekude ye-line side loopback function ukuququzelela uvavanyo lwemigca ye-E1;
- Inkxaso yesixokelelwano sasekhaya sokusetwa kwakhona kwenkqubo ekude;
- bonelela nge-remote interface loopback umyalelo, kulula ukucwangcisa ukugcinwa;
- Ujongano lolawulo lweConsole lubonelela ngokuvuleleka ngokulula kofakelo;
- Imodyuli yolawulo lwenethiwekhi yoqwalaselo, inkxaso yolawulo lwenethiwekhi yeSNMP ezimeleyo;
- ngesi siphelo kwimboniselo ubume bomsebenzi wokubonisa isixhobo esikude;
- Iinketho ezininzi zemowudi yamandla: AC220V, DC-48V / DC24V kunye nokunye;
- I-DC-48V / DC24V unikezelo lwamandla kunye nomsebenzi wokufumanisa polarity oluzenzekelayo, xa ifakwe ngaphandle kokwahlula phakathi kokulungileyo nokubi.
Iiparamitha
♦E1 Interface
uMgangatho weNdibaniselwano: thobela iprotocol G.703;
Ireyithi yoNxibelelwano: n * 64Kbps ± 50ppm;
IKhowudi yoNxibelelwano: HDB3;
I-E1 Impedance: 75Ω (ukungalingani), 120Ω (ibhalansi);
Ukunyamezela kweJitter: Ngokuhambelana neprotocol G.742 kunye ne-G.823
Ukuqwalaselwa okuvunyelweyo: 0 ~ 6dBm
♦Ujongano lwe-Ethernet (10/100M)
Ireyithi yokunxibelelana: 10/100 Mbps, isiqingatha/i-duplex epheleleyo-thethwano oluzenzekelayo
I-Interface Standard: Iyahambelana ne-IEEE 802.3, IEEE 802.1Q (VLAN)
Isakhono sedilesi ye-MAC: 4096
Isidibanisi: RJ45, inkxaso ye-Auto-MDIX
♦ Indawo yokusebenza
Ubushushu bokusebenza: -10°C ~ 50°C
Ukufuma okuSebenzayo: 5% ~ 95 % (akukho ukujiya)
Ubushushu bokugcina: -40°C ~ 80°C
Ukufuma kokuGcina: 5% ~ 95 % (akukho ukujiya)
